Once again, Tony Popovic faced a few big surprises in the election. And they don’t include Maty Ryan or Jackson Irvine, who remain on the bench, meaning Patrick Beach and Paul Okon Jr (or Paul Okon-Engstler) retain their places.
Surprises are at the forefront. The two players who scored against Türkiye, Nestory Irankunda and Connor Metcalfe, are on the bench. He is replaced by Mathew Leckie, one of Popovic’s former favorites at Melbourne Victory, and Nishan Velupillay in the starting line-up.
Velupillay hasn’t had the best season in the A-League but has delivered every time he has been called up to the Socceroos. This will be his ninth cap.
